首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

等待在没有承诺的情况下执行的操作集

是指一组操作,这些操作在没有明确的承诺或保证的情况下被执行。这意味着这些操作可能会在任何时间点被执行,没有确定的顺序或时间表。

在云计算领域,等待在没有承诺的情况下执行的操作集通常与异步编程模型相关。异步编程模型允许在执行操作时不阻塞主线程或进程,从而提高系统的并发性和响应性。

在开发过程中,等待在没有承诺的情况下执行的操作集可以用于处理需要长时间执行的操作,例如网络请求、文件读写、数据库查询等。通过将这些操作设置为异步执行,可以避免阻塞主线程或进程,提高系统的性能和用户体验。

在前端开发中,可以使用JavaScript的异步编程模型来处理等待在没有承诺的情况下执行的操作集。常见的方法包括使用回调函数、Promise对象、async/await等。

在后端开发中,可以使用各种编程语言和框架提供的异步编程模型来处理等待在没有承诺的情况下执行的操作集。例如,在Node.js中可以使用回调函数或Promise对象,而在Python中可以使用async/await等。

在云原生应用开发中,可以使用容器编排工具如Kubernetes来管理等待在没有承诺的情况下执行的操作集。通过将应用程序部署为容器,并使用Kubernetes进行自动化管理和扩展,可以更好地处理异步操作和提高应用程序的可靠性。

在网络通信中,等待在没有承诺的情况下执行的操作集可以用于处理异步消息传递、事件驱动编程等场景。例如,使用消息队列系统如RabbitMQ或Apache Kafka可以实现异步消息传递,从而提高系统的可伸缩性和可靠性。

在网络安全领域,等待在没有承诺的情况下执行的操作集可能涉及到处理异步安全事件、监控和响应等。例如,使用实时日志分析工具和安全信息与事件管理系统可以帮助检测和响应异步安全事件,提高系统的安全性。

在音视频和多媒体处理中,等待在没有承诺的情况下执行的操作集可以用于处理异步的音视频编解码、转码、剪辑等任务。通过使用专业的音视频处理库和云服务,可以实现高效的异步处理和分发。

在人工智能领域,等待在没有承诺的情况下执行的操作集可以用于处理异步的机器学习训练、推理等任务。通过使用分布式训练框架和异步推理引擎,可以提高机器学习模型的训练和推理效率。

在物联网应用中,等待在没有承诺的情况下执行的操作集可以用于处理异步的传感器数据采集、设备控制等任务。通过使用物联网平台和云服务,可以实现异步的数据处理和设备管理。

在移动开发中,等待在没有承诺的情况下执行的操作集可以用于处理异步的网络请求、数据同步等任务。通过使用移动开发框架和云服务,可以实现高效的异步操作和数据交互。

在存储领域,等待在没有承诺的情况下执行的操作集可以用于处理异步的文件上传、下载、备份等任务。通过使用云存储服务和分布式文件系统,可以实现高可靠性和高性能的异步存储操作。

在区块链领域,等待在没有承诺的情况下执行的操作集可以用于处理异步的交易确认、智能合约执行等任务。通过使用分布式账本和共识算法,可以实现异步的交易处理和合约执行。

在元宇宙领域,等待在没有承诺的情况下执行的操作集可以用于处理异步的虚拟世界交互、资源加载等任务。通过使用分布式计算和网络技术,可以实现高并发和低延迟的异步操作。

总之,等待在没有承诺的情况下执行的操作集是云计算领域中常见的概念,与异步编程模型密切相关。通过合理地使用异步编程模型和相关技术,可以提高系统的性能、可靠性和用户体验。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

没有 Mimikatz 情况下操作用户密码

在渗透测试期间,您可能希望更改用户密码常见原因有两个: 你有他们 NT 哈希,但没有他们明文密码。将他们密码更改为已知明文值可以让您访问不能选择 Pass-the-Hash 服务。...您没有他们 NT 哈希或明文密码,但您有权修改这些密码。这可以允许横向移动或特权升级。...一旦离线,Mimikatz可以在不被发现情况下使用,但也可以使用Michael Grafnetter DSInternals 进行恢复。...使用 Impacket 重置 NT 哈希并绕过密码历史 PR 1171 奖励:影子凭证 我们是否需要重置 esteban_da 密码才能控制它?答案实际上是否定,我们没有。...如果我们要删除GenericWrite并重新运行BloodHound集合,我们会看到: 额外 BloodHound 边缘 我们现在看到了四 (4) 个我们以前没有看到边缘。

2K40

尽量减少网站域名在没有启用 CDN 情况下各种检测、扫描、测速操作

今天明月给大家分享个比较可怕事儿,那就是轻松获取你站点服务器真实 IP 途径和办法,很多小白站长不知道自己服务器真实 IP 重要性,因此一些不好习惯就会暴露你真实 IP 到网上,从而造成被各种恶意扫描和爬虫抓取骚扰...这个原理其实很简单,就是通过获取你域名解析记录来侧面获取到你真是 IP,有不少第三方代理就可以扫描你域名来获取到这些数据,不说是百分百准确吧,至少有 80%概率可以,通过明月分析,这些数据大部分依赖于平时网上各种所谓...SEO 分析平台、互换友链平台等等,甚至不少测速平台数据都会被利用到,像有些所谓安全检查扫描一类也会获取到这里数据。...这几乎是一种没有任何成本和技术门槛手法就可以轻松获取到服务器真实 IP 了,这也再次说明了给自己站点加个 CDN 来隐藏真实 IP 重要性,甚至可以说在没有 CDN 情况下,尽量不要去检测自己域名速度...、SEO 信息查询等等操作,至于那些所谓交换友链、自动外链所谓 SEO 插件就更要远离了,基本上明月碰到没有几个是正常,总之各位是要小心谨慎了!

1.1K20
  • 没有技术术语情况下介绍Adaptive、GBDT、XGboosting提升算法原理简介

    假设你正在准备SAT考试,考试分为四个部分:阅读、写作、数学1(没有计算器)、数学2(没有计算器)。为了简单起见,假设每个部分有15个问题需要回答,总共60个问题。...这削弱了我们目的。 这也是为什么对于不平衡数据,提升算法比随机森林和决策树给出了更稳健分析。提升算法将能够更好地预测少数族裔模型纳入其中。...Gradientboost不使用树桩,因为它没有使用树来检测困难样本。它构建树来最小化残差。...当面对大型数据时,这个过程可能非常耗时。 因此,XGboost又向前推进了一步。它没有使用预估器作为树节点。它构建树来将残差进行分组。就像我之前提到,相似的样本会有相似的残值。...树节点是可以分离残差值。因此,XGboost中叶子是残差,而XGboost中树节点是可以对残差进行分组值! XGboost速度使它真正适用于大型数据

    86210

    简单复习下 JS 中 Set 常用集合操作:并、差、交集、对称差

    在许多情况下,需要比较多个列表,获取它们有或没有交集、差等等,在 JavaScript 有一个数据类型可以很好实现这些需求,那就是 Set 。 Set对象就像一个数组,但是仅包含唯一项。...,可以使用 Set,下面大家描述一下适用场合,主要就是数据里集合操作: 获取两个集合 union 获取两个集合 difference 获取两个集合交集 intersection 获取两个集合对称差...Set 操作 在数学中,每当谈论集合时,都可以执行一些操作,实际上,Set 是数学有限计算机实现方式。...操作将返回一个新集合,新集合只包含在一个集合中并且不在另一个集合中元素,即数学概念。...intersectionDifference intersectionDifference 操作将返回其中包含两个集合没有交集所有元素新集合。

    2.2K20

    没有训练数据情况下通过领域知识利用弱监督方法生成NLP大型标记数据

    在二元分类问题情况下,标签为0(不存在标签)或1(标签存在)或-1(信息不足,不标记)。...但是一般情况下两阶段方法优于单阶段方法,因为这样可以选择任何LM和EM组合,通过不同组合可以找到最佳性能。因此本文还是使用将步骤1和步骤2分开进行。...从上图也能够看到没有单标签模型(LM)框架始终优于其他框架,这表明我们必须在数据集中尝试不同LMS才能选择最佳LMS。...这也是基准测试中针对于小标签数据执行初始化步骤最佳方法之一。 Snorkel Snorkel可以说是所有弱监督标签模型方法创始者,可以说是弱监督标签模型方法之母!...在两步弱监督方法中结合这些框架,可以在不收集大量手动标记训练数据情况下实现与全监督ML模型相媲美的准确性! 引用: Want To Reduce Labeling Cost?

    1.2K30

    在GAN中通过上下文复制和粘贴,在没有数据情况下生成新内容

    我相信这种可能性将打开数字行业中许多新有趣应用程序,例如为可能不存在现有数据动画或游戏生成虚拟内容。 GAN 生成对抗网络(GAN)是一种生成模型,这意味着它可以生成与训练数据类似的现实输出。...GAN局限性 尽管GAN能够学习一般数据分布并生成数据各种图像。它仍然限于训练数据中存在内容。例如,让我们以训练有素GAN模型为例。...尽管它可以生成数据集中不存在新面孔,但它不能发明具有新颖特征全新面孔。您只能期望它以新方式结合模型已经知道内容。 因此,如果我们只想生成法线脸,就没有问题。...但是,如果我们想要眉毛浓密或第三只眼脸怎么办?GAN模型无法生成此模型,因为在训练数据中没有带有浓密眉毛或第三只眼睛样本。...快速解决方案是简单地使用照片编辑工具编辑生成的人脸,但是如果我们要生成大量像这样图像,这是不可行。因此,GAN模型将更适合该问题,但是当没有现有数据时,我们如何使GAN生成所需图像?

    1.6K10

    执行交换操作最小汉明距离(并查

    注意,你可以按 任意 顺序 多次 交换一对特定下标指向元素。 相同长度两个数组 source 和 target 间 汉明距离 是元素不同下标数量。...在对数组 source 执行 任意 数量交换操作后,返回 source 和 target 间 最小汉明距离 。...示例 2: 输入:source = [1,2,3,4], target = [1,3,2,4], allowedSwaps = [] 输出:2 解释:不能对 source 执行交换操作。...解题 并查学习,请点击 对可以交换下标位置,使用并查进行合并 对 source 数组中每个位置数,属于哪个集合,计数 遍历 target 数组,对每个位置数,查看对应集合,看是否存在,记录数量...,并更新计数 class dsu // 并查 { public: vector f; dsu(int n) { f.resize(n);

    57920

    论我是如何在没有可移动存储介质情况下重装了一台进不去操作系统电脑

    由 ChatGPT 生成文章摘要 博主在这篇文章中分享了一个有关在没有可移动存储介质情况下如何重装进不去操作系统电脑经历。文章描述了博主帮亲戚检测电脑后,意外地导致电脑无法启动。...这篇文章详细介绍了整个过程,并分享了具体操作步骤,为读者提供了一个解决类似问题参考。...论我是如何在没有可移动存储介质情况下重装了一台进不去操作系统电脑 前言 前几天推荐家里亲戚买了台联想小新 Pro 16 笔记本用来学习用,由于他们不怎么懂电脑,于是就把电脑邮到我这儿来让我先帮忙检验一下...瞬间,我脑子轰般炸开 —— 坏了,我手上可没有 U 盘可以拿来重装系统啊!...查看问题 没有办法,我只能硬着头皮看看能不能修好,电脑状态是 BIOS 自检完成后无法引导进操作系统自动重启,并在重启两次后自动进入 WinRT 恢复环境。

    36920

    微信浏览器点击文件上传提示没有应用可执行操作解决方法

    一个 Vue 项目,使用 AntDesign for Vue 前端框架。图片上传使用 Upload 组件,在微信访问 H5 页面,点击图片上传时提示“没有应用可执行操作”。如下图所示: ?...实际上这不是 AntDesign 锅,我部分代码: <a-upload     class="upload-modal"     :action="action"     :headers="headers...使用 js 进行文件格式控制 ,AntDesign <em>的</em> Upload 组件有一个 :beforeUpload 属性。...官方给出<em>的</em>解释:上传文件之前<em>的</em>钩子,参数为上传<em>的</em>文件,若返回 false 则停止上传。...$message.error('请上传jpg或png格式<em>的</em>图片!');     }     return isJpgOrPng; }, 本文已加入 腾讯云自媒体分享计划 (点击加入)

    5.7K20

    混合模式程序是针对“v2.0.50727”版运行时生成,在没有配置其他信息情况下,无法在 4.0 运行时中加载该...

    今天在把以前写代码生成工具从原来.NET3.5升级到.NET4.0,同时准备进一步完善,将程序都更新后,一运行程序在一处方法调用时报出了一个异常: 混合模式程序是针对“v2.0.50727”版运行时生成...,在没有配置其他信息情况下,无法在 4.0 运行时中加载该程序 其调用方法是从sqlite数据库中获取原来已经使用过数据库连接,当时也没注意,就是准备设断点然后单步调试,结果竟然是断点无法进入方法体内...),而目前官方也没有给出最新.NET4数据访问支持。...,.NET3.5时候,由于程序运行环境本质还是.NET2.0,而到了.NET4.0由于整个程序版本更新,以前使用.NET2.0所编写程序与.NET4.0程序继续拧互操作时候就会出现上面所说兼容性问题...4 激活策略,该激活策略将加载 .NET Framework 4 通过使用公共语言运行时 (CLR) 版本 4 所创建程序,以及 CLR 早期版本通过使用受支持低于版本 4 最高 CLR 版本所创建程序

    2.2K100

    【DB笔试面试378】展现应用程序依赖关系,以对源代码、可执行程序发布进行系统建模,应采用UML图是_____图。

    Q 题目 设用UML设计某数据库应用系统,设计人员规划了一组应用程序,该集合由动态链接库和可执行程序构成。...为了展现这些应用程序组织和依赖关系,以对源代码、可执行程序发布进行系统建模,应采用UML图是_____图。...答案 答案:组件 DB笔试面试历史连接 http://mp.weixin.qq.com/s/Vm5PqNcDcITkOr9cQg6T7w About Me:小麦苗 ● 本文作者:小麦苗,只专注于数据库技术...,更注重技术运用 ● 作者博客地址:http://blog.itpub.net/26736162/abstract/1/ ● 本系列题目来源于作者学习笔记,部分整理自网络,若有侵权或不当之处还请谅解

    23550

    【错误记录】解压 Linux 内核报错 ( Can not create symbolic link : 客户端没有所需特权 | Windows 中配置 7z 命令行执行解压操作 )

    文章目录 一、报错信息 二、解决方案 一、报错信息 ---- 二、解决方案 ---- 查看 7zip 软件安装路径 E:\Program Files\7-Zip , 其中 7z.exe 和 7z.dll...就是执行所需命令 ; 配置环境变量 : 右键点击文件目录左侧 " 此电脑 " , 在弹出菜单中选择属性选项 : 在电脑属性中 , 选择 " 高级系统设置 " , 然后逐步设置环境变量 , 将...7zip 软件安装目录设置到环境变量中 ; 右键点击底部 命令提示符 图标 , 在 命令提示符 选项上 , 再次点击右键 , 选择 " 以管理员身份运行 " 选项 ; 进入到 Linux 源码目录..., 执行 7z x linux-5.6.18.tar 命令 , 解压 Linux 源码 ; 解压过程中 , 没有上述报错 , 成功解压 ; 执行结果 : D:\004_Operate\Kernel\

    3.6K10

    ElasticSearch压测工具:esrally离线使用详解

    默认情况下,其工作方式是:在线获取其位于海外主机上数据,然后在本地执行压测。因此,在国内网络情况下(或某些没有网络主机上),在线获取数据这一步骤将非常耗时甚至无法完成。...任意路径下执行下列命令,等待结果即可(我们默认使用数据 geonames) esrally race --pipeline=benchmark-only --target-hosts=10.0.0.145...我们依旧以 geonames 数据为例 我们在elastic官网github上可以看到esrally数据相关描述 https://github.com/elastic/rally-tracks...数据下载完成后,需要放置在CentOS的如下路径,若没有geonames路径,则手工创建: image.png 3,使用离线数据进行压测 任意路径执行下列命令(务必在命令最后使用 --offline...当然,这一系列操作,目的是为了,下次进行压测时,直接可以使用上面离线数据,而无需漫长地等待在线下载了。 最后,我们可以看到压测过程如下图。

    7.3K106

    RxJS 快速入门

    商家把商品交给快递公司,给快递公司一个订单号(老回执)并拿回一个运单号(新回执) 快递公司执行这个新承诺,这个过程中商家不用等待(异步) 快递公司完成这个新承诺,你收到这个新承诺携带商品 所以,事实上...比如,Promise 特点是无论有没有人关心它执行结果,它都会立即开始执行,并且你没有机会取消这次执行。显然,在某些情况下这么做是浪费甚至错误。...工人只需要待在自己工位上,对面前原料进行加工,然后放回传送带上或放到另一条传送带上即可,简单、高效、无意外 —— 符合程序员审美。...要注意是,当 Promise 作为参数传给 fromPromise 时,这个 Promise 就开始执行了,你没有机会防止它被执行。...这个操作符几乎总是放在最后一步,因为 RxJS 各种 operator 本身就可以对流中数据进行很多类似数组操作,比如查找最小值、最大值、过滤

    1.9K20

    spark调优系列之高层通用调优

    Spark自动会根据文件大小,是否可分割因素来设置map数目(后面会详细讲解输入格式,同时详细讲解各种输入map数决定)。...二,Reduce任务内存使用 有时候内存溢出并不是由于你RDD不适合放在内存里面,而是由于你某个task工作太大了,比如使用groupbykey时候reduce任务数据太大了。...Sparkshuffle操作(sortByKey, groupByKey, reduceByKey, join, etc)会构建一个hash表,每个task执行一个分组数据,单个往往会很大。...Spark倾向于调度任务依据最高数据本地性,但这往往是不可能。在任何空闲Executor上没有未处理数据情况下,Spark会切换到较低数据本地性。...具体配置如下: 属性 默认值 含义 spark.locality.wait 3s 超时时间,放弃等待在较低数据本地性新启任务。

    78270

    面试必备|spark 高层通用调优

    一,并行度 如果并行度设置不足,那么就会导致集群浪费。Spark自动会根据文件大小,是否可分割因素来设置map数目(后面会详细讲解输入格式,同时详细讲解各种输入map数决定)。...二,Reduce任务内存使用 有时候内存溢出并不是由于你RDD不适合放在内存里面,而是由于你某个task数据太大了,比如使用groupbykey时候reduce任务数据太大了。...Sparkshuffle操作(sortByKey, groupByKey, reduceByKey, join, etc)会构建一个hash表,每个task执行一个分组数据,单个往往会很大。...Spark倾向于调度任务依据最高数据本地性,但这往往是不可能。在任何空闲Executor上没有未处理数据情况下,Spark会切换到较低数据本地性。...具体配置如下: 属性 默认值 含义 spark.locality.wait 3s 超时时间,放弃等待在较低数据本地性新启任务。

    91210
    领券